Efficient Land Clearing with Skid Steer Power

Wiki Article

Land clearing operations require powerful equipment to get the job done quickly and effectively. Skid steers are becoming increasingly popular for land clearing because of their adaptability.

These compact machines can tackle a broad range of tasks, from clearing trees and brush to grading and excavating. With the right attachments, skid steers can efficiently clear even the most challenging terrain.

A key advantage of using a skid steer for land clearing is its mobility. They can easily navigate limited spaces, making them ideal for working in areas where larger equipment would struggle.

Skid steers are also relatively affordable, which makes them a attractive option for both large and small projects.

Various factors contribute to the overall cost of land clearing. The size of the area to be cleared is a primary influence. Rugged terrain, dense vegetation, and the existence of obstacles such as trees or boulders can also increase costs. Moreover, the disposal of debris and the need for authorizations add to the financial burden.

Land Clearing Made Easy: Skid Steer vs. Mini Excavator Showdown

When it comes to conquering land for construction or development, you've got two major players: the skid steer and the mini excavator. Both are versatile tools, but which one reigns supreme? It depends your individual job demands. Skid steers are known for their versatility, making them perfect for navigating tight spaces and handling a selection of attachments. Mini excavators, on the other hand, pack more digging force and can tackle larger tasks with ease.

First, consider the size of your job. A small area might be easily managed by a skid steer, while a larger excavation could require the muscle of a mini excavator.

A well-planned land removal project begins with a thorough evaluation of the site. Factors like soil type, vegetation density, and existing structures must be carefully analyzed to determine the most effective approach. Once you have a clear understanding of the land's characteristics, you can begin to formulate a plan that minimizes environmental get more info impact while maximizing efficiency.

Various methods are available for land removal, ranging from manual labor to heavy machinery. The choice will depend on the size and complexity of the project, as well as budgetary factors. Traditional methods like hand-clearing with tools such as axes and chainsaws are often suitable for smaller projects or areas with sensitive ecosystems. However, for larger-scale operations, machinery like bulldozers, excavators, and loaders can significantly increase efficiency and productivity.

Regardless of the chosen method, it is crucial to prioritize safety throughout the entire land removal process. Always w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E), such as gloves, goggles, and steel-toed boots, and follow manufacturer guidelines for operating machinery.
